Demise of Rt. Rev. Julius Danaraj PaulThe Council of Churches of Malaysia is shocked and deeply saddened by the tragic news of the demise of the Rt. Rev. Julius Danaraj Paul, the Bishop of the Evangelical Lutheran Church of Malaysia on 22nd November 2008 at a boat mishap on Lake Atitian in Guatemala. He was 63 years old. Bishop Paul was there to attend a Lutheran World Federation Conference. The CCM mourns the loss of a devoted servant of the Gospel who had given his life for the cause of ecumenism. Bishop Paul, as one of the long-serving ecclesiastical leaders in our country, had offered outstanding leadership to the Council of Churches of Malaysia, and other ecumenical organizations in the region (CCA) and globally (LWF). He participated actively in the formation of the Seminari Theoloji Malaysia and the Christian Federation of Malaysia and served in important positions in those organizations. Bishop Julius had enjoyed great respect and admiration from other church and government leaders as he was a passionate and relentless advocate of justice and peace in the country. As an ecumenist he had always sought the common ground so that churches could effectively impact social change in society.
